Can you clarify if you have 1Password for Safari installed from the Mac App Store? It's a companion app (extension for Safari) for 1Password 8. Also please note 1Password 8 is a new app and as such you'll need to re-enable things like Touch ID inside the 1Password 8 settings.

OK - I found the Browser button in 1PW8 settings where it allows you to attach the browser. It seems to work a lot better now - I'm not sure why this wasn't mentioned anywhere.
